Dablehar Population - Jammu, Jammu and Kashmir
Dablehar is a large village located in Ranbir Singh Pora Tehsil of Jammu district, Jammu and Kashmir with total 762 families residing. The Dablehar village has population of 3505 of which 1813 are males while 1692 are females as per Population Census 2011.In Dablehar village population of children with age 0-6 is 385 which makes up 10.98 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Dablehar village is 933 which is higher than Jammu and Kashmir state average of 889. Child Sex Ratio for the Dablehar as per census is 604, lower than Jammu and Kashmir average of 862.
Dablehar village has higher literacy rate compared to Jammu and Kashmir. In 2011, literacy rate of Dablehar village was 82.98 % compared to 67.16 % of Jammu and Kashmir. In Dablehar Male literacy stands at 90.40 % while female literacy rate was 75.44 %.

Dablehar Data
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total No. of Houses | 762 | - | - |
Population | 3,505 | 1,813 | 1,692 |
Child (0-6) | 385 | 240 | 145 |
Schedule Caste | 1,035 | 566 | 469 |
Schedule Tribe | 114 | 60 | 54 |
Literacy | 82.98 % | 90.40 % | 75.44 % |
Total Workers | 877 | 759 | 118 |
Main Worker | 600 | - | - |
Marginal Worker | 277 | 219 | 58 |
